Why Professional Transfer Over a Standard Taxi? <a name=”why-professional-transfer”></a>

The debate over Gudauri Transfer Prices Taxi vs Private Transfer often boils down to “perceived” vs “actual” costs. While a local taxi at the airport might quote a lower starting rate, travelers often encounter hidden “winter surcharges” once the driver sees the snow depth or the amount of ski gear.   • Fixed Pricing: Private transfers offer a locked-in rate (typically starting from $70–$90 for a sedan) that includes fuel, tolls, and wait times.
  • Specialized Equipment: Standard taxis in Tbilisi are often not equipped with high-quality winter tires or snow chains. In our years on the road, we’ve seen countless two-wheel-drive taxis struggle on the incline past Pasanauri. Winter Gudauri Transfer
  • Cargo Capacity: Private transfers allow you to book a vehicle with a ski rack specifically, whereas a random taxi may require you to hold your skis inside the cabin, compromising safety.

Gudauri Special: Winter Road Logistics

The road to Gudauri is the Georgian Military Highway. It is beautiful but requires respect.

Insider Tip #2: Between January and March, the Jvari Pass often implements a “one-way” or “trailer-only” restriction during heavy snow. Our drivers monitor the Roads Department (Georoad.ge) updates in real-time. We’ve observed that travelers using private transfers are often notified of closures before leaving the airport, allowing for a comfortable wait in Tbilisi rather than being stuck in a 5-hour queue in the cold.

2026 Route Comparison Table

RouteDistanceEst. TimePrice Est. (Private)Vehicle Type
Tbilisi Airport to Gudauri145 km2.5 – 3 hrs$85 – $1104×4 SUV / Minivan
Kutaisi Airport to Gudauri310 km5.5 – 6 hrs$180 – $220Minivan
Tbilisi to Kazbegi (Stepantsminda)155 km3.5 hrs$110 – $1304×4 SUV
Tbilisi to Yerevan (Armenia)290 km5 – 6 hrs$210 – $250Sedan / Minivan

FAQ: Real-World Traveler Questions

Q: Is it cheaper to take a marshrutka (minibus) to Gudauri? A: A marshrutka is the cheapest option (~15 GEL), but they do not offer luggage space for skis, do not go door-to-door, and can be dangerously overcrowded in winter.

Q: Do private transfer prices include stops? A: Yes. Unlike taxis that might charge for extra time, our private transfers allow for a 15-minute grocery or SIM card stop as part of the fixed price.

Q: How do I know if the road to Gudauri is open? A: We monitor the Roads Department of Georgia 24/7. If the road is closed due to avalanche risk, we coordinate with you to reschedule or wait safely.
